Suzanne Harvey Obituary

Obituary published on Legacy.com by Holt Funeral Home on Feb. 23, 2026.
Suzanne T. Harvey, 70, of Woonsocket, passed away on February 20, 2026, in Valley View Nursing Home, Woonsocket, surrounded by her close family. The wife of the late Jeffrey Harvey, Suzanne, was born in Woonsocket and was the daughter of the late Lucien and Theresa (Perron) Desjardins.
During her years, Suzanne worked conscientiously as an early education assistant for Head Start and ABC Child Care. Being able to teach these children was truly her passion and something she held very close to her heart. She found endless joy in not only teaching but also connecting and caring for the numerous children she had the pleasure of meeting along the way. She always made time for crafts, having a different crafting project for every holiday and season. Apple picking was her favorite in the fall, making sure to find her twin apples every time. Rod Stewart was her favorite singer; ask anyone she knew, and they could tell you how much she loved his music. Cooking was another true passion of Suzanne's; her chicken soup was a family favorite, and her recipes will still be made and loved even though she is gone. A lot of her time was spent in New Hampshire, whether it was for leaf peeping season or being at the ocean. Her time there was heavily cherished.
She lives on in her children, who carry her love with them every day. Jennifer Fernandes and her sons, Joseph and Joshua Fernandes, of Woonsocket. Joshua Fontaine and his wife, Crystal King, along with their children, Josie, Jenna, and Jaxson Fontaine of Douglas. Before her own passing, Suzanne carried the profound loss of her granddaughter, Jordan Fontaine, daughter of Joshua Fontaine, deep in her heart. Her memory also lives on through her siblings, Paul Desjardins and his wife Karen, and Pauline Thibeault and her husband Leo, all of Woonsocket. Even though they may not be blood, two bonus grandchildren, Sophia and Olivia Dempsey, will hold Suzanne close to their hearts forever.
Private funeral arrangements are under the direction of the Holt Funeral Home, 510 South Main Street, Woonsocket, RI 02895.
